m^2-6m-78=-4
We move all terms to the left:
m^2-6m-78-(-4)=0
We add all the numbers together, and all the variables
m^2-6m-74=0
a = 1; b = -6; c = -74;
Δ = b2-4ac
Δ = -62-4·1·(-74)
Δ = 332
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:$m_{1}=\frac{-b-\sqrt{\Delta}}{2a}$$m_{2}=\frac{-b+\sqrt{\Delta}}{2a}$
The end solution:
$\sqrt{\Delta}=\sqrt{332}=\sqrt{4*83}=\sqrt{4}*\sqrt{83}=2\sqrt{83}$$m_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-6)-2\sqrt{83}}{2*1}=\frac{6-2\sqrt{83}}{2} $$m_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-6)+2\sqrt{83}}{2*1}=\frac{6+2\sqrt{83}}{2} $
